Twin car bombs in Baghdad kill 17 people and wound at least 50

A double car bomb attack near the Baghdad police major crimes headquarters killed and wounded several policemen along with their rescuers on Tuesday (July 31st).

"The first car bomb attack targeted the police headquarters in Karrada, killing six policemen and wounding 22," Baghdad Police official Lt. Colonel Khalid Abdul Khaliq said.

He added that the building was severely damaged by the attack.

"Five minutes later, another car bomb exploded while police and rescuers were evacuating the dead and wounded, killing 11 people, including 9 policemen, and wounding 30 others," Abdul Khaliq said.

Abdul Khaliq added that security forces killed a suicide bomber who tried to carry out a third attack by entering through the building’s back gate, which was destroyed following the attacks.
